EXCEEDS logo
Exceeds
Gregory Austin

PROFILE

Gregory Austin

Over a three-month period, this developer enhanced the UKHomeOffice/modern-slavery and UKHomeOfficeForms/hof repositories by delivering targeted features and reliability improvements. They consolidated exploitation-related content and user experience across multiple pages, modernized form validation, and removed legacy HTML, using JavaScript, CSS, and HTML to improve data quality and guidance. In UKHomeOfficeForms/hof, they implemented source map support and build debugging enhancements for SASS and JavaScript builds, updating build configurations and adding unit tests. Additionally, they addressed file upload reliability by improving error handling and validation, ensuring robust API integration and backend stability. Their work emphasized maintainability, traceability, and developer productivity.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

6Total
Bugs
2
Commits
6
Features
2
Lines of code
458
Activity Months3

Work History

August 2025

1 Commits

Aug 1, 2025

August 2025: Reliability upgrade in UKHomeOffice/modern-slavery. Implemented a critical file upload bug fix that ensures errors are caught and surfaced from the request, validates that a URL is present in the response, and added unit tests to cover error handling scenarios.

July 2025

2 Commits • 1 Features

Jul 1, 2025

July 2025 monthly summary for UKHomeOfficeForms/hof. Key focus: debugging observability and release traceability. Delivered Source Map Support and Build Debugging Enhancements for SASS and JavaScript builds, including build configuration updates, exorcist integration, unit tests, and accompanying docs. Feature enabled by default in non-production environments, reducing debugging time and improving issue reproduction. Also completed Release Tag Update (Version Bump) to ensure versioning consistency and traceability despite no code changes. Overall, improved developer productivity, observability, and release discipline.

March 2025

3 Commits • 1 Features

Mar 1, 2025

Month: 2025-03. Key features and UX updates delivered for UKHomeOffice/modern-slavery, with a focus on clear guidance and data quality in exploitation workflows. Consolidated exploitation-related content and user experience across multiple pages (taken-somewhere, details-last-contact, location specification). Improvements include clearer instructions, updated content and structure, removal of the legacy HTML view, enhanced form guidance, bullet-point clarity, and improved labeling and validation of the location field. No separate bug-fix tickets were recorded; fixes were delivered as part of feature/content work, including validation enhancements and legacy view removal. Impact: improved user guidance, reduced ambiguity, and more reliable data capture across the exploitation workflow, enabling better compliance and reporting. Technologies/skills demonstrated: content-driven UX updates, cross-page content consolidation, front-end validation improvements, migration away from legacy HTML, and thorough commit-level traceability (NRM-385, NRM-387, NRM-396, NRM-398).

Activity

Loading activity data...

Quality Metrics

Correctness73.4%
Maintainability70.0%
Architecture60.0%
Performance66.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

CSSHTMLJavaScript

Technical Skills

API IntegrationBackend DevelopmentBuild ToolsCSSCSS PreprocessingConfiguration ManagementContent ManagementDebuggingError HandlingFront End DevelopmentFrontend DevelopmentHTMLJavaScriptTestingUnit Testing

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

UKHomeOffice/modern-slavery

Mar 2025 Aug 2025
2 Months active

Languages Used

HTMLJavaScript

Technical Skills

CSSContent ManagementFront End DevelopmentFrontend DevelopmentHTMLJavaScript

UKHomeOfficeForms/hof

Jul 2025 Jul 2025
1 Month active

Languages Used

CSSJavaScript

Technical Skills

Build ToolsCSS PreprocessingConfiguration ManagementDebuggingJavaScriptTesting